APPLICATION OF THE ETHEREUM BLOCKCHAIN PLATFORM FOR THE DEVELOPMENT OF A DECENTRALIZED VOTING SYSTEM
DOI:
https://doi.org/10.24867/10BE09MalencicKeywords:
distributed systems, blockchain, smart contractsAbstract
This work will present the possibilities for the application of blockchain technology in supporting voting systems and describe the development of such a system using the example of an Ethereum blockchain platform application. The application is implemented in a distributed and decentralized fashion, so as to explore the positive and negative aspects of a software solution of this type.
References
[1] Dr Dušan Gajić, Materijali sa predmeta Paralel-ni i distribuirani algoritmi i strukture podataka, dostupno na: http://www.acs.uns.ac.rs/sr/node/237/4468699, poslednji pristup jul 2020.
[2] Maarten van Steen, Andrew S. Tanenbaum., Distributed Systems (third edition), Maarten van Steen 2018.
[3] Don Tapscott, Blockchain Revolution, Penguin Random House LLC 2016.
[4] Blockchain Consesnus, dostupno na: https://devopedia.org/blockchain-consensus , poslednji pristup mart 2020.
[5] Truffle , dostupno na: www.trufflesuite.com, poslednji pristup jul 2020.
[6] Ethereum, dostupno na: https://ethereum.org/en/, poslednji pristup jul 2020.
[7] Web3js, dostupno na: https://web3js.readthedocs.io/en/v1.2.11/, poslednji pristup jul 2020.
[8] Metamask, dostupno na: https://metamask.io/, poslednji pristup jul 2020.
[2] Maarten van Steen, Andrew S. Tanenbaum., Distributed Systems (third edition), Maarten van Steen 2018.
[3] Don Tapscott, Blockchain Revolution, Penguin Random House LLC 2016.
[4] Blockchain Consesnus, dostupno na: https://devopedia.org/blockchain-consensus , poslednji pristup mart 2020.
[5] Truffle , dostupno na: www.trufflesuite.com, poslednji pristup jul 2020.
[6] Ethereum, dostupno na: https://ethereum.org/en/, poslednji pristup jul 2020.
[7] Web3js, dostupno na: https://web3js.readthedocs.io/en/v1.2.11/, poslednji pristup jul 2020.
[8] Metamask, dostupno na: https://metamask.io/, poslednji pristup jul 2020.
Downloads
Published
2020-10-25
Issue
Section
Electrotechnical and Computer Engineering